The four-fermion interaction in D=2,3,4: a nonperturbative treatment

Abstract

A new nonperturbative approach is used to investigate the Gross-Neveu model of four fermion interaction in the space-time dimensions 2, 3 and 4, the number N of inner degrees of freedom being a fixed integer. The spontaneous symmetry breaking is shown to exist in D=2,3 and the running coupling constant is calculated. The four dimensional theory seems to be trivial.
